meaning of ingrain

1. Dyed with grain, or kermes.
2.
Dyed before manufacture, -- said of the material of a textile fabric; hence, in general, thoroughly inwrought; forming an essential part of the substance.
3.
An ingrain fabric, as a carpet.
4.
To dye with or in grain or kermes.
5.
To dye in the grain, or before manufacture.
6.
To work into the natural texture or into the mental or moral constitution of; to stain; to saturate; to imbue; to infix deeply.
7.
produce or try to produce a vivid impression of; "Mother tried to ingrain respect for our elders in ">us"
